Senior DevOps Engineer (AWS, Cloud)

ABOUT CLIENT

Our client is using new technology to develop products for the banking industry

JOB DESCRIPTION

We are in need of an experienced Senior DevOps Engineer (AWS) to join our team. This role is essential in supporting our engineering and business operations. The ideal candidate will be responsible for implementing tools and processes that facilitate rapid development and deployment of software.
The main responsibility is to adopt continuous integration/deployment in a delivery pipeline that performs automated quality checks, deploys cloud infrastructure and applications quickly, and offers operational tooling and metrics for use by development teams. Success in this role requires a combination of development and operational experience, providing an understanding of the developers you work with while ensuring critical systems uptime.

JOB REQUIREMENT

Required Qualifications
A deg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field.
Proficiency in Linux operating systems management.
Familiarity with Docker and container orchestration, such as ECS/EKS.
Knowledge of AWS CloudFormation/Terraform/CDK for infrastructure provisioning.
Understanding of source control concepts (e.g., Gitlab/Git flow, Trunk base, branches).
Experience with CI/CD tools or configuration management tools.
Proficiency in at least one programming language (e.g., Python, Bash).
Understanding of networking, firewalls, load balancers, high availability.
Strong English communication skills and the ability to engage with both business and technical teams.
Strong problem-solving abilities and logical thinking.
Self-learning attitude and an eagerness to explore and acquire new knowledge.
Experience in SDLC and Agile methodologies.
Ability to work effectively both independently and as part of a team.
 
Preferred Qualifications
Previous experience in the banking or finance industry.
AWS certification(s) related to Advanced Networking.
AWS Certified DevOps Engineer - Professional.
